II. Specific Requirements for Advanced Age Surrogacy in Kyrgyzstan
In 2026, the requirements for advanced age surrogacy in Kyrgyzstan mainly focus on three aspects: physical condition, legal documents, and medical evaluation. Regarding age, although the law does not set an absolute upper limit, medical institutions usually recommend that the woman be under 50 years old. Those over 50 need to provide a more comprehensive health examination report, including key indicators such as cardiovascular function, endocrine levels, and endometrial condition. The commissioning party needs to provide valid identification, proof of marital status, and medical proof of the necessity for fertility. Furthermore, all procedures involving surrogacy must be completed through formal reproductive centers and legal institutions to ensure the legal validity of the surrogacy agreement.
III. Detailed 2026 Latest Procedure
The standard procedure for advanced age surrogacy in Kyrgyzstan has become more standardized in 2026, mainly divided into the following steps: Step one, online consultation and preliminary evaluation, submitting recent medical reports and personal situation descriptions; Step two, traveling to Kyrgyzstan for an in-person medical evaluation and signing legal documents; Step three, entering the ovulation induction and egg retrieval cycle, simultaneously screening the surrogate and performing embryo transfer; Step four, pregnancy confirmation via blood test 12 to 14 days after transfer; Step five, pregnancy management and delivery. The entire process cycle is approximately 12 to 16 months, with the specific duration varying depending on individual physical conditions and embryo status.
IV. Cost Analysis of Advanced Age Surrogacy in Kyrgyzstan
In 2026, the overall cost of advanced age surrogacy in Kyrgyzstan remains relatively transparent, with a total cost range of approximately 350,000 to 550,000 RMB. This specifically includes medical examination fees, ovulation induction medication costs, egg retrieval surgery fees, embryo culture and screening fees, compensation and care fees for the surrogate, legal consultation service fees, and newborn document processing fees. Due to the decline in egg quality for older individuals, additional embryo genetic screening or multiple embryo transfers may be necessary, and these costs will increase accordingly based on the actual situation. Compared with European and American countries, Kyrgyzstan's cost advantage remains significant, which is an important reason for its popularity.
